The Hot Iron is a UK-based professional ironing and laundry service with door-to-door collection and delivery, rather than a SaaS or enterprise software product in the strict sense. Users can check service availability and book online, or contact the company by phone. Staff collect garments from the doorstep and usually return them washed, ironed, or folded within 24–48 hours. Its network covers more than 60 towns across England, Scotland, and Wales, positioning it between a traditional local ironing helper and a high-priced commercial dry cleaner.
Based on the available information, its core services include garment ironing, wash-dry-fold, wash-dry-iron, dedicated shirt ironing, bedding and duvet cover handling, school uniforms, wedding/special-occasion clothing, Asian garments, as well as use cases such as Airbnb, holiday lets, B&Bs, and workwear/aprons for small businesses. It emphasizes locally trained staff, professional-grade steam irons and ironing boards, smoke-free clean environments, customizable preferences for trouser creases/folding/hanging, and operational technology such as automatic notifications and an enterprise-level customer management system, though it does not disclose details of its software backend capabilities.
Pricing is relatively transparent: ironing is charged per item, with adult shirts or dresses at around £1.80, T-shirts/POLO shirts around £1.35, and jeans/trousers around £1.35. Laundry is charged by load, with a 7kg full-load wash-dry-fold starting from around £14.05, and wash-dry-iron starting from around £22.37. Most customer orders fall in the £20–£30 range. Collection and delivery are free for orders over £20, while smaller orders may incur a fee. Payment is made upon delivery by bank transfer or cash.
The advantages include a simple booking process, convenient door-to-door collection and delivery, clear per-item/per-load pricing, fast turnaround times, and a damage compensation commitment. The drawbacks are that the service depends on geographic coverage, so availability must be checked first; it does not offer dry cleaning; and, from the software-focused perspective relevant to this category, it does not disclose information about APIs, third-party integrations, team permissions, data security certifications, or self-hosting.
It is best suited to busy households in the UK, working professionals, people who need regular shirt ironing, and small B&Bs or businesses looking for low-complexity laundry outsourcing.
